Memo — Revised Commission Scheme

To: Heads of Department, Varnell & Grace

Effective next quarter, commission moves to a tiered model: 2.5% base, 5% above target, annual cap removed. Applies to all field teams including the Ashdown branch. Draws reconciled monthly, not quarterly. Payroll cutover handled by Finch in Operations. Direct questions to your divisional lead before Friday's call. The confidential business-planning note appears directly below.

management briefing: Headcount on the Aldion team goes from 31 to 76 by the end of April. Gross margin on Aldion came in at 24 percent against a plan of 21 percent.

**Checklist item 7: Deep-link routing (Pellbright mobile)**

Verify that all registered deep links resolve correctly on both platforms, including the new gift-card path and the legacy order-history routes. Confirm fallback behavior when the app is not installed sends users to the Pellbright landing flow, not a 404. Routing table was regenerated this morning; validate it against the token below.

session token of tajef-bageg = htk21_5d90d574934f3ccae6437

Subject: Quickstore 4.2 — bloom filter now fronts the KV layer

Plugin authors: starting with this release, Quickstore places a bloom filter ahead of the key-value store. Negative lookups return faster; false positives fall through safely. No API changes are required on your side. Verify your plugin against the staging build referenced below.

session token of fahif-tadup = htk3_9c7